Two Italian Dogs are Fostering Little Baby Cats

Usually, cats and dogs don’t get along. But, fortunately, there are cases when the stereotype is broken.

Meet Luna and Giulio, the two Italian dogs who are raising dozens of kittens. Luna, a mix breed rescue dog was adopted four years ago, while Giulio, a Jack Russel Terrier joined the family two years ago. Their home is Zampa Onlus, a cat rescue non-profit organization, and both of the dogs have a heartwarming mission; they are taking care of baby kittens, both healthy and ill.

“They are very active dogs, but among little kittens they become gentle and have a lot of patience” the owner shared with Bored Panda.

Zampa Onlus relies only on donations they receive from their followers and supporters. You can find the rescue on Instagram and Facebook, where they share adorable images of Luna, Giulio, and their foster babies.
